Как найти остаток от деления целого числа

Поиск от числа является важной задачей в различных областях науки и индустрии. От типа задачи и доступных ресурсов зависит выбор подходящего метода. Существует несколько основных способов нахождения от числа, которые подходят для разных ситуаций.

Первый и наиболее простой способ нахождения от числа — деление на другое число. В случае, если искомое число делится на заданное без остатка, то результатом будет целое число. Этот метод удобен, когда изначально известно, на какое число производится деление.

Третий способ нахождения от числа — использование математических формул и уравнений. В некоторых случаях можно определить от число, используя числовые и алгебраические операции. Например, для нахождения квадратного корня числа можно использовать формулу или функцию в программировании.

Однако, стоит помнить, что выбор способа нахождения от числа зависит от конкретной задачи и доступности необходимых инструментов. Советуем применять различные методы в зависимости от контекста и требуемой точности результата.

Метод деления с остатком

Для использования этого метода нужно разделить исходное число на делитель. При этом, если деление произошло без остатка, то искомое число найдено. Если же при делении получен остаток, то число не является от целого числа.

Пример:

Для проверки числа 25 на отделение от числа 6, нужно разделить 25 на 6 и получить остаток.

25 / 6 = 4, остаток 1

Остаток 1 говорит о том, что число 25 не является от целого числа по отношению к числу 6.

Метод деления с остатком является достаточно простым и удобным для проверки чисел на отделение. Он может быть использован для нахождения от целого числа для различных целей, таких как программирование, математика и прочие области, где требуется проверка чисел.

Использование встроенных математических функций

Например, в языке Python для нахождения от числа можно использовать функцию abs(), которая возвращает абсолютное значение числа. Это позволяет избегать отрицательных результатов в случае, если исходное число было отрицательным.

Если вам нужно округлить число до ближайшего целого, можно воспользоваться функцией round(). Она округляет десятичное число до ближайшего целого и возвращает результат.

Если вам нужно найти наибольшее или наименьшее из двух чисел, используйте функции max() и min() соответственно. Они принимают два аргумента и возвращают максимальное и минимальное значение из них.

Если вы хотите найти квадратный корень из числа, можете воспользоваться функцией sqrt(). Она вычисляет квадратный корень из числа и возвращает результат.

Использование встроенных математических функций может значительно упростить процесс нахождения от целого числа. Ознакомьтесь с документацией по своему языку программирования, чтобы узнать, какие функции доступны для использования.

Алгоритм последовательного вычитания

Для использования алгоритма последовательного вычитания необходимо выполнить следующие шаги:

  1. Запишите уменьшаемое и вычитаемое число.
  2. Проверьте, является ли вычитаемое число больше уменьшаемого. Если нет, то воспользуйтесь другим способом нахождения разности.
  3. Вычитайте вычитаемое число из уменьшаемого. Если результат меньше нуля, то воспользуйтесь альтернативным методом или завершите алгоритм.
  4. Запишите результат вычитания и используйте его как новое уменьшаемое число.
  5. Повторяйте шаги 3 и 4 до тех пор, пока результат не станет меньше или равен нулю.
  6. Когда результат станет равен нулю, записанный результат будет являться разностью между исходными числами.

Применение алгоритма последовательного вычитания может быть полезно при решении различных задач, где необходимо находить разность между целыми числами. Он может использоваться как для простых вычислений, так и для более сложных математических задач.

Применение оператора модуля для нахождения остатка

Основная идея оператора модуля заключается в нахождении остатка от деления одного числа на другое. Если результат деления равен 0, то числа делятся без остатка, в противном случае получаем остаток.

Например, при использовании оператора модуля для числа 10 и делителя 3 мы получим остаток 1, так как 10 делится нацело на 3 два раза, остаток равен 1.

Оператор модуля может использоваться для различных задач. Например, при работе с большими числами он позволяет упростить сложные арифметические операции. Также, оператор модуля может быть полезен при проверке числа на четность или нечетность.

Оператор модуля широко применяется в программировании и может быть использован для решения различных задач. Он помогает эффективно работать с целыми числами и находить остатки от деления.

Использование битовых операций для определения знака

Для определения знака целого числа можно использовать операцию побитового сдвига вправо (>>). При использовании этой операции знаковый бит числа копируется вправо и заполняет все биты числа. Если значение знакового бита равно 1, то число отрицательное, если значение равно 0, то число положительное.

К примеру, рассмотрим число -5, представленное в двоичной системе: 1111111111111011. Выполнив операцию побитового сдвига вправо, получим число 1111111111111111. Знаковый бит числа -5 равен 1, следовательно, число отрицательное.

Другой способ определения знака числа — использование операции побитового «и» (&). При выполнении операции побитового «и» на число и маску, состоящую из единиц и нулей, результатом будет число, в котором сохраняется только знаковый бит. Если результат равен 0, то число положительное, если ненулевое значение, то число отрицательное.

Например, рассмотрим число -10, представленное в двоичной системе: 1111111111110110. Выполнив операцию побитового «и» на число и маску, состоящую из единиц только в знаковом бите (1000000000000000), получим результат 1000000000000000. Значение не равно 0, следовательно, число отрицательное.

Использование битовых операций для определения знака числа является эффективным и быстрым способом, особенно в случаях, когда не требуется получение точного значения числа, а необходимо только определить его знак.

Оцените статью